
Fiberglass is a high-performance composite material, typically made from glass fibers and resin, known for its strength and versatility. To guarantee its safety and durability in various applications, conducting mechanical tests is crucial. Our advanced testing machines are capable of evaluating key parameters such as tensile, bending, compression, fatigue, and impact strength. These tests help ensure that fiberglass panels and products perform reliably under real-world conditions.

Common Mechanical Tests for Fiberglass
- Tensile strength testing
- Bending strength testing
- Compression testing
- Fatigue testing
- Impact resistance testing
